Change Details: The authors hereby declare that the Figure 4 in page eight of the paper “Stem cells from human exfoliated deciduous teeth modulate early astrocyte response after spinal cord contusion” authored by Fabrício Nicola and colleagues (DOI: 10.1007/s12035-018-1127-4) was mistakenly included.
Compliance with Ethical Standards
: All procedures were in accordance with the Guide for the Care and Use of Laboratory Animals adopted by the National Institute of Health (USA) and with the Federation of Brazilian Societies for Experimental Biology and with the Brazilian Law for Laboratory Animals care n11.794. The experimental study was approved by the Research Ethics Committee of the University (#26116). The procedures for obtaining and isolate the SHED were approved by the Ethics Committee of the Universidade Federal do Rio Grande do Sul (#296/08).
